Job Description
We are looking for a General Dentist to join our busy practice in Fort Smith AK. This established practice offers a steady patient flow and high productivity. We are a growing practice that needs an associate who is looking to grow their career! We use the most advanced materials and procedures available practicing comfortable health-centered dentistry with a strong emphasis on understanding the whole patient while minimizing any negative impact on the environment or patient. If you are looking for a practice with a full schedule where you have the autonomy to treatment plan your cases collaborate with colleagues and work in a positive team-oriented environment this is the opportunity for you!
Perks:
- Working for a doctor-owned practice
- Complete clinical autonomy
- Mentorship
- Health Insurance
- CE Allowance
Job Duties:
- Examine diagnose prescribe and carry out services and treatment plans.
- Collaborate with other providers as well as all other clinical and non-clinical personnel as necessary.
- Uphold the policy protocol and procedures which are in compliance with the most current accepted professional standards.
- Improving clinical skills and acumen through participation in continuing education and training opportunities (continuing education support is available).
- Participate in various community outreach initiatives as necessary.
Required Experience:
- DDS/DMD from a dental education program accredited by the Commission on Dental Accreditation.
- Current valid license to practice dentistry in state where providing care (License must be in good standing) or eligible for licensure.
- Other certifications as required by state to include- CPR DEA etc.
